    IBO/WBO/WBA/IBF heavyweight champion Wladimir Klitschko (56-3, 49KOs) is planning to fight three times in 2012. He already has a unified defense scheduled for March 3rd in Dusseldorf, against former cruiserweight champion Jean-Marc Mormeck (36-4, 22KOs). Klitschko will then meet his mandatory obligation against the IBF's number one ranked challenger, Tony Thompson. Klitschko previously stopped Thompson (36-2, 24KOs) in eleven rounds in 2008. The Thompson rematch will happen on July 7th or July 14th, according to Wladimir. After those two fights are resolved, Wladimir would like to have his third appearance of the year in the month of October.
